An "Open Source License" is a # license that conforms to the Open Source Definition (Version 1.9) # published by the Open Source Initiative. # Please submit bugfixes or comments via https://bugs.opensuse.org/ # # git revision %global vc_gitrev 294bff4ef87427743d0b35c0f7eb1b34a6dd061b # custom paths and variables %global vflags -cc gcc -d dynamic_boehm %global vexe_root %{_libexecdir}/%{name} %global vexe %{vexe_root}/%{name} Name: vlang Version: 0.5 Release: 0 Summary: The V Programming Language License: MIT AND BSD-2-Clause URL: https://vlang.io/ Source0: https://github.com/%{name}/v/archive/%{version}/%{name}-%{version}.tar.gz Source1: https://github.com/%{name}/vc/raw/%{vc_gitrev}/v.c Source99: vlang-rpmlintrc Patch1: 0001-Link-to-distro-provided-mbedtls.patch Patch2: 0002-Disable-vdoc-testing.patch BuildRequires: (c_compiler or gcc) BuildRequires: diffutils BuildRequires: fdupes BuildRequires: findutils BuildRequires: pkgconfig # For VFLAGS="-d dynamic_boehm" BuildRequires: pkgconfig(bdw-gc) BuildRequires: pkgconfig(mbedcrypto) BuildRequires: pkgconfig(mbedtls) BuildRequires: pkgconfig(mbedx509) # For vshare tool BuildRequires: pkgconfig(x11) # For VFLAGS="-d dynamic_boehm" # Required by compiler at runtime Requires: pkgconfig(bdw-gc) # For the net.mbedtls module Requires: pkgconfig(mbedcrypto) Requires: pkgconfig(mbedtls) Requires: pkgconfig(mbedx509) %description V is a statically typed compiled programming language inspired by Go but with a more low-level approach, similar to C or Rust. %package examples Summary: Examples for the V Programming Language BuildArch: noarch %description examples V is a statically typed compiled programming language inspired by Go but with a more low-level approach, similar to C or Rust. This package contains examples for the V Programming Language. %prep %autosetup -n v-%{version} -p1 %build export CC=cc export CFLAGS="${CFLAGS} -std=gnu11 -pthread -w" # Distro specific build flags %{set_build_flags} export VFLAGS="%{vflags}" %if 0%{?sle_version} == 150500 export STAGE0_FLAGS='-lm -lpthread -lrt' %else export STAGE0_FLAGS='-lm -lpthread' %endif export STAGE1_FLAGS='-no-parallel' %ifarch x86_64 %{ix86} export STAGE2_FLAGS='-prod -nocache' %else export STAGE2_FLAGS='-nocache' %endif # stage 0: build the V compiler from the transpiled C code ${CC} ${CFLAGS} ${LDFLAGS} ${STAGE0_FLAGS} -o %{name}-stage0 %{SOURCE1} # stage 1: build without parallelism ./%{name}-stage0 ${VFLAGS} ${STAGE1_FLAGS} -o %{name}-stage1 cmd/v # stage 2: build with parallelism and -prod ./%{name}-stage1 ${VFLAGS} ${STAGE2_FLAGS} -o %{name}-stage2 cmd/v # stage 3: rebuild and check diff ./%{name}-stage2 ${VFLAGS} ${STAGE2_FLAGS} -o %{name} cmd/v diff --strip-trailing-cr -u %{name}-stage2 %{name} if [ $? -eq 0 ]; then echo "Stage 3 build differs from the final build, please check the output above." fi # Replace some tools with dummy scripts echo "println('\"%{name} up\" is disabled for the packaged versions of V')" > cmd/tools/vup.v echo "println('Use your package manager to update V')" >> cmd/tools/vup.v echo "println('\"%{name} self\" is disabled for the packaged versions of V')" > cmd/tools/vself.v echo "println('Use your package manager to update V')" >> cmd/tools/vself.v # TODO: Skipping building vdoc until https://github.com/vlang/markdown is embedded in build sed -i -e "/^const tools_in_subfolders/s/ 'vdoc',//" cmd/tools/vbuild-tools.v rm -rf cmd/tools/vdoc # Set to not-empty to skip build-time V module cloning with `git` export VTEST_SANDBOXED_PACKAGING='yes' # Build-time configuration export VEXE="%{_builddir}/%{buildsubdir}/%{name}" export VMODULES="%{_builddir}/%{buildsubdir}/.vmodules" export VJOBS="%{?jobs:%jobs}" # Print information about the build ./%{name} doctor # Build V tools ./%{name} test-self ./%{name} -v build-tools # Do not attempt to rebuild after installation echo 'disable' > cmd/tools/.disable_autorecompilation chmod 0444 cmd/tools/.disable_autorecompilation %install # Remove development files rm -rf \ cmd/tools/*/tests \ cmd/tools/fuzz \ cmd/tools/vpm/expect \ cmd/tools/install_wabt.vsh \ cmd/tools/*/testdata \ cmd/tools/install_binaryen.vsh \ cmd/tools/git_pre_commit_hook.vsh \ cmd/tools/bench/map_clear_runner.vsh \ cmd/tools/check_retry.vsh # Remove test files rm -rf \ vlib/*/tests \ vlib/*/*/tests \ vlib/*/*/*/tests \ vlib/*/slow_tests \ vlib/*/testdata \ vlib/*/*/testdata \ vlib/*/*/*/testdata \ vlib/v/pkgconfig/test_samples \ vlib/net/http/mime/build.vsh \ # Remove .gitignore files find . -type f -name '.gitignore' -print -delete # Replace hardcoded path to v in examples sed -i -e '1s:%{_prefix}/local/bin/v:%{_bindir}/%{name}:' examples/v_script.vsh # Copy files install -D -m 0755 %{name} %{buildroot}%{vexe} cp -R -t %{buildroot}%{vexe_root} cmd vlib # Install third-party headers install -d %{buildroot}%{vexe_root}/thirdparty cp -R -t %{buildroot}%{vexe_root}/thirdparty \ thirdparty/stdatomic \ %{nil} # Run-time configuration wrapper # TODO: Add a proper VTMP install -d %{buildroot}%{_bindir} echo '#! %{_bindir}/sh export VEXE="%{vexe}" export VCACHE="${HOME}/.cache/%{name}" export VFLAGS="%{vflags}" exec ${VEXE} $@ ' > %{buildroot}%{_bindir}/%{name} chmod 755 %{buildroot}%{_bindir}/%{name} # symlink /usr/bin/vlang to /usr/bin/v ln -rs %{buildroot}%{_bindir}/%{name} %{buildroot}%{_bindir}/v # Remove executable bits from examples find examples -type f -exec chmod 0644 {} \; # Copy examples install -d %{buildroot}%{_datadir}/doc/%{name}/ cp -R -t %{buildroot}%{_datadir}/doc/%{name}/ examples # Create shell completion files mkdir -p %{buildroot}%{_datadir}/bash-completion/completions %{buildroot}%{vexe} complete setup bash > %{buildroot}%{_datadir}/bash-completion/completions/%{name} sed -i 's|%{buildroot}||g' %{buildroot}%{_datadir}/bash-completion/completions/%{name} mkdir -p %{buildroot}%{_datadir}/zsh/site-functions %{buildroot}%{vexe} complete setup zsh > %{buildroot}%{_datadir}/zsh/site-functions/_%{name} sed -i 's|%{buildroot}||g' %{buildroot}%{_datadir}/zsh/site-functions/_%{name} mkdir -p %{buildroot}%{_datadir}/fish/vendor_completions.d %{buildroot}%{vexe} complete setup fish > %{buildroot}%{_datadir}/fish/vendor_completions.d/%{name}.fish sed -i 's|%{buildroot}||g' %{buildroot}%{_datadir}/fish/vendor_completions.d/%{name}.fish # Remove duplicate files %fdupes %{buildroot}%{_libexecdir}/%{name}/ %fdupes %{buildroot}%{_datadir}/doc/%{name}/examples %files %license LICENSE %doc CHANGELOG.md README.md %doc doc/docs.md doc/vscode.md doc/img tutorials %{_bindir}/v %{_bindir}/%{name} %{_libexecdir}/%{name} # bash completion %dir %{_datadir}/bash-completion %dir %{_datadir}/bash-completion/completions %{_datadir}/bash-completion/completions/%{name} # zsh completion %dir %{_datadir}/zsh %dir %{_datadir}/zsh/site-functions %{_datadir}/zsh/site-functions/_%{name} # fish completion %dir %{_datadir}/fish %dir %{_datadir}/fish/vendor_completions.d %{_datadir}/fish/vendor_completions.d/%{name}.fish %files examples %dir %{_datadir}/doc/%{name}/ %{_datadir}/doc/%{name}/examples %changelog
